Alani Golanski is a nationally prominent
business and appellate litigator with many years of
experience in complex commercial, government contracts,
products liability and business litigations that have
raised a host of cutting edge substantive, procedural
and constitutional issues. Mr. Golanski is prepared
to represent and defend your business or institution
in litigation, and he is currently litigating several
large business and contract disputes in various state
and federal courts. Mr. Golanski also has special expertise handling civil appeals and
juvenile delinquency cases.
In conjunction with his practice, he
has written legal briefs and published several articles
on the uses of science and social science in law. Mr.
Golanski, a James Kent Scholar at the Columbia University
School of Law, is a member of the Bars of the States
of New York, New Jersey and Connecticut, the United
States Supreme Court, Federal appellate courts in numerous
circuits, and several United States District Courts,
including the United States Court of Federal Claims,
which has jurisdiction over cases involving bid protests
and government contracts.
Among his many projects, Mr. Golanski
is litigating a number of major government contract
disputes and Federal bid protests on behalf of several
corporations before the United States Court of Federal
Claims, the Government Accountability Office, and the
Armed Services Board of Contract Appeals. Mr. Golanski
has also served as New York counsel in the
In re Johns-Manville
Corporation bankruptcy proceedings on behalf of asbestos
personal injury and wrongful death claimants bringing
actions against Manville’s former insurers.
